3 Types of Mini Padel Rackets (And Who They're For)
1. Realistic Replicas
What they are: Scaled-down versions (roughly 20-25cm) of actual popular padel rackets, with authentic detailing, hole patterns, and color schemes. They look like the real thing, just smaller.
Who they're for: Collectors, padel fans who want a desk piece or display item, tournament organizers giving prizes, and anyone who appreciates craftsmanship.
2. Baby & Toddler Toys
What they are: Soft, safe, sensory-friendly padel rackets made from plush, fabric, or foam. Designed for tiny hands — they squeak, rattle, and crinkle. BPA-free, machine washable.
Who they're for: Padel-playing parents with babies aged 0-3, baby shower gift buyers, and anyone who wants the cutest photo op known to humanity.
3. Keyrings & Collectibles
What they are: Tiny (5-10cm) racket-shaped keyrings and charms, usually in plastic or leather. Often branded with real racket designs.
Who they're for: Stocking stuffers, bag charms, party favors at padel events, and the "I need padel in every part of my life" crowd.
Quick Guide: Racket Shapes Explained
Even mini replicas follow the same three shapes as real padel rackets. Here's what each shape means — useful whether you're buying a replica or a real junior racket for your kid.
Diamond
PowerWeight concentrated at the top. Maximum power, less control. For aggressive attackers. Think: Bullpadel Vertex, Adidas Metalbone.
Teardrop
All-RoundBalanced sweet spot. The best of both worlds. Most popular shape overall. Think: NOX AT10, Babolat Viper, HEAD Speed.
Round
ControlCentral sweet spot. Maximum control and forgiveness. Best for beginners and defensive players. Think: HEAD Extreme, Wilson Bela.

What to Look for When Buying a Mini Padel Racket
If it's a gift for a baby
Safety first. Look for BPA-free materials, no small detachable parts, and machine washability. Check for age ratings — most baby padel toys are designed for 0-12 or 0-24 months. Sensory features (squeakers, rattles, crinkle fabric) are a huge bonus since they turn a novelty item into a toy that actually gets used.
If it's a display replica
Detail matters. The best replicas have accurate hole patterns, realistic grip wraps, miniaturized text, and authentic color schemes. HEAD's official minis set the bar here. Size matters too — the 20cm display models have much more visual impact than 8cm keyrings. Consider buying a small acrylic stand for proper display.
If it's a stocking stuffer or party favor
Go for keyrings or 3D printed versions. They're affordable enough to buy in bulk, come in tons of colors, and are durable enough for daily use. HEAD's official keyrings are the safest bet for quality, but Etsy's 3D printed options give you custom colors and text for a personal touch.
Frequently Asked Questions
Are mini padel rackets safe for babies?
Dedicated baby padel toys (like the HEAD Baby Pack) are designed with baby safety in mind — soft materials, no small parts, BPA-free. However, display replicas and keyrings are NOT toys and should be kept away from babies and young children. Always check age ratings.
Can kids actually play padel with a mini racket?
No — mini rackets (under 30cm) are toys, collectibles, or display pieces. For actual play, kids need a proper junior padel racket, which typically starts at around 33cm for ages 5-6 and goes up to 38cm for ages 10-12. We have a separate guide to junior padel rackets by age.
What brands make official mini padel rackets?
As of April 2026, HEAD is the only major padel brand producing official miniature replicas and keyrings (Radical, Extreme, Speed, and Coello lines). Bullpadel, NOX, Babolat, Adidas, and Wilson do not yet offer mini versions of their rackets. We expect this to change as the market grows.
